Part of Fulton County, Kentucky is completely surrounded by Missouri and Tennessee and unconnected from the rest of the state. So, Kentucky is actually composed of two unconnected pieces of land...probably wouldn't be considered a "land mass" though...
Volcanic islands in the deep ocean are primarily composed of basaltic igneous rocks. Basalt is formed from the rapid cooling of lava erupted from underwater volcanoes, resulting in a fine-grained, dark-colored rock. It is the most common rock type found on volcanic islands like Hawaii and Iceland.

Please note that the correct spelling of Hawii is Hawaii.The Hawaiian Islands are an archipelago of 19 islands and atolls, numerous smaller islets, and undersea sea-mounts in the North Pacific Ocean, extending some 1,500 miles (2,400 km) from the island of Hawaii in the south to northernmost Kure Atoll. Excluding Midway, which is an unincorporated territory of the United States, the Hawaiian Islands form the US state of Hawaii. Once known as the "Sandwich Islands", the archipelago now takes its name from the largest island in the group.

Indonesia is considered a fragmented state. It is composed of more than 13,000 islands. It is also called an archipelago, which is a group of islands that are recognized as a country.
Yes, high islands are composed of volcanoes and volcanic debris. On the other hand low islands are composed of coral remains.
